Description
The Council wishes to procure a "commercial off-the-shelf" insurance claims handling and recording system with the added consideration of a workflow and document storage facility, to enable the Council to become a virtually 'paperless' operation.
The contract will be awarded on the 6th March 2017 and if necessary the data will be transferred and system implemented and live by 6th July 2017. The contract will run from 6th March 2017 for two years until 5th March 2019. The Council will have the option to extend the contract every two years up to 5th March 2027. (2+2+2+2+2)
